Cleveland-Cliffs Suspends HBI Project Construction in Ohio

Cleveland-Cliffs Inc. CLF announced that it is temporarily shutting down construction activities at its hot-briquetted iron (“HBI”) project site in Toledo, OH, effective Mar 20, following the guidelines from Ohio Governor’s office regarding the coronavirus pandemic.

The company will continue to analyze the COVID-19 situation and restart construction activities at its HBI project site as soon as possible. Notably, all other iron ore mining and steelmaking facilities of Cleveland-Cliffs will continue to operate.

The HBI facility was expected to start commercial production in the first half of 2020. On its fourth-quarter earnings call, the company expected to achieve nameplate capacity of 1.9 million metric tons of HBI in 2021, the first full calendar year of operation of the facility.

Shares of Cleveland-Cliffs have plunged 66% in the past year compared with the industry’s 38.6% decline.

In February, the company said that it expects average iron ore prices, steel prices and pellet premiums of $90 per metric ton, $650 per short ton and $50 per metric ton, respectively, for 2020. Based on the assumptions, it expects to generate net income of $300-$325 million and adjusted EBITDA of $550-$575 million for 2020 on a stand-alone basis.
